📍 THE STRATEGIC LOCATION GUIDE: WHERE & WHY

San Diego’s greatest strength is its ability to “double” for almost any location in the world. Use this guide to match your brand’s intent with the perfect backdrop.

🏙️ The “Tech-Forward & Modern” Look

Best For: SAAS Startups, Luxury Automotive, High-End Corporate, Wellness Apps.

  • The Salk Institute (La Jolla): * The Why: Renowned for its brutalist concrete and teak architecture. It screams “Genius,” “Innovation,” and “Timelessness.” The “River of Life” water feature flowing toward the Pacific is the ultimate high-end backdrop.

🌊 The “Luxury & High-Society” Look

Best For: Jewelry, Swimwear, High-End Fashion, Real Estate.

  • La Jolla Shores & The Cove:
    • The Why: Sweeping cliffs, emerald water, and Mediterranean-style villas perched on the hillside. It is the “Monte Carlo of California.” The La Jolla Shores location has wide beaches ideal for long shots, while The Cove location has the famous seal colony and craggy rocks jutting out of the ocean.
    • Intent: High-fashion “Resort Wear” or luxury lifestyle products.

  • The Del Mar Racetrack & Fairgrounds:
    • The Why: “Where the Turf Meets the Surf.” Old-world Spanish architecture and manicured turf.
    • Intent: “Old Money,” equestrian fashion, or “Summer Socialite” themes.

🏔️ The “Outdoors & Adventure” Look

Best For: Activewear, Overlanding/Off-road Gear, Fitness, Camping Equipment.

  • Sunset Cliffs Natural Park:
    • The Why: Dramatic, jagged bluffs and crashing waves. At sunset, the lighting is unparalleled for “Epic” hero shots.
    • Intent: “Solo Adventure,” “Freedom,” and “Extreme Fitness.”
  • Anza-Borrego Desert State Park:
    • The Why: Mars-like terrain, slot canyons, and massive rusted iron sculptures.
    • Intent: Automotive “Toughness,” survival gear, or sci-fi fashion.

  • Mount Laguna / Julian:
    • The Why: Alpine meadows and pine forests. In winter, it provides a “Snowy Mountain” look just 60 minutes from the city.
    • Intent: Winter apparel, cozy home goods, and outdoor “PNW” (Pacific Northwest) vibes.

💡 The Producer’s “Scout Tip”:

The 30-Mile Rule: You can shoot a “Snowy Mountain” scene in Mount Laguna at 8:00 AM and a “Sunset Surf” scene in Encinitas at 5:00 PM on the same day. No other region in the U.S. offers this level of geographic diversity within a single permit-zone.
